Mi'kmaw Ceremonies

Smudging Ceremony

Fasting

Fasting is done in order to cleanse the body and the mind to better communicate with the Creator. Anyone entering this ceremony must fast (abstain from food) for at least four days.

Vision Quest

A personal and sacred ceremony, the Vision Quest helps an individual to communicate with the Creator, and gain a greater understanding of nature and spirit. It is undertaken by a person reaching a critical point in his/her life, such as the transition from adolescence to adulthood.

Talking Circles

Talking Circles are used to resolve issues or problems in our community and to provide guidance.

The Pipe Ceremony

After a period of fasting, the pipe ceremony takes place for the purpose of exchanging information. The pipe ceremony is given by the community’s healer or medicine man.

Smudging

Smudging is not an actual ceremony, but an act of blessing which precedes all Mi’kmaw ceremonies. The smoke from the smoldering sweet grass is thought to cleanse the body and spirit.
